Language: 
To browser these website, it's necessary to store cookies on your computer.
The cookies contain no personal information, they are required for program control.
  the storage of cookies while browsing this website, on Login and Register.

Author Topic:  ArchWizard  (Read 103 times)

0 Members and 1 Guest are viewing this topic.

Dolfo

« on: 22, September 2022, 14:16:51 »
Finally i have come to a point, where i can show my archwizard idea in public.

You can find it here.

https://github.com/Kamor/ArchWizard

The idea of archwizard was to speed up the process of managing all the arc data. This tool is very basic. I released it under version 0.0.  :o

Tool needs java runtime environment, same as we need for the mapeditor. First you need to adjust the archwizard.ini to set the path to archfolder and optional a path to an extern editor you like.

There are more information in README.md and in archwizard.txt about this.

Tool need some time when reading or writing a lot of data. Think of 1000 and more textfiles the tool is accessing. So you need to wait on init or reset process depending on the amount of data. I only tested this with the public trunk data. So please be patience, the program is not hanging.

Most powerful is the search field. For example search for "type 6" and you get all the food data. Or search for "Object bread" or "Object bre*". More informations about this you find in archwizard.txt.

Tool has an own small table view, also with edit functionality, if you want to change fast some definitions.

like changing the food value of bread, it's
press ctrl-o (same as typing Object+whitespace) in searchfield
typing bread behind it+return
toogle to table view, click the food column.
write new entry
press ctrl-w (or use menufunction) to write this back to the arcfile.

for more complex changes you can also mark more cells in the table and rightclick it to overwrite all marked cells with one value.

finally you can export the data to .csv format, browse and change all the data in extern programms like excel or librecalc and import data back.

please be carefully, if you use very complex import/export mechanics, you can always check the debug logs, if all gone right.

tool has also a small backup functionalty.

...

but at some points it's still very raw
If you export data without their unique informations (Object or artefact) you can't import it back.

You can also use "null" to delete attributes, but be carefully if you use "null" on the end attribute, this will delete the end line and make the data unreadable for both daimonin server and also archwizard.  :P
« Last Edit: 22, September 2022, 17:10:27 by Dolfo »
Don't believe the shit, you hear in mainstream. Believe your own body. Your body is speaking always the true to you. But you need to understand your body. Hear to your body, not to your ego. And when body is calling to you: "Hey something is wrong!" find the reason(s) for that. Man in White don't go for that, they don't want to heal you. They want earn money and sell you medicine, you should take rest of your life. You are not the patient, you are their customer. Never forget this!

Tags: